Understanding AI Operating Systems

An AI operating system is a comprehensive platform combining AI-driven tools and automation to manage business processes. Unlike traditional software, it integrates AI agents to handle tasks such as content generation, data analysis, and customer interactions. According to McKinsey, AI systems can significantly enhance workplace productivity by automating routine tasks.

AI Operating System: A centralized platform that uses AI to automate and optimize business processes, integrating various tools and workflows into a single system.

Core Components of an AI Operating System

  1. AI Agents: Perform specific tasks like content creation, editing, or data analysis.
  2. Workflow Automation: Streamlines repetitive tasks, reducing human intervention.
  3. Data Integration: Aggregates data from multiple sources for comprehensive insights.
  4. Scalability: Adapts to growing business needs without significant reconfiguration.

Building the Framework

I began by mapping out the key processes that could benefit from automation and AI enhancement. This included content generation, editorial workflows, marketing automation, and customer analytics.

Step 1: Content Generation

Content is the lifeblood of any publishing company. My goal was to automate the initial draft creation process using AI. Tools like Open AI's GPT-4 provided a robust foundation.

  • Implementation: We trained models on our existing content to ensure alignment with our brand voice.
  • Outcome: Reduced initial content creation time by 30%, allowing editors to focus on refining and fact-checking.

Step 2: Editorial Workflows

Managing deadlines and revisions can be chaotic. By implementing AI-driven project management tools, we streamlined editorial processes.

  • Integration: Used AI to monitor deadlines, track changes, and suggest improvements.
  • Result: Increased editorial efficiency by 25%, reducing time spent on administrative tasks.
QUICK TIP: Use AI to automate scheduling and reminders, freeing up time for creative tasks.

Step 3: Marketing Automation

Automating marketing efforts was crucial for expanding our reach. AI tools helped us optimize campaigns and target the right audience segments. According to TechNative, AI can significantly enhance marketing performance by personalizing content delivery.

  • Tools Used: Platforms like Hub Spot and custom AI models.
  • Impact: Achieved a 15% increase in conversion rates by personalizing content and timing.

Step 4: Customer Analytics

Understanding our audience was key to providing value. AI-enabled analytics tools offered deeper insights into customer behavior. As noted by Staffing Industry Analysts, AI-driven analytics can unlock significant revenue potential by enhancing customer insights.

  • Approach: Deployed predictive analytics to forecast trends and tailor offerings.
  • Advantage: Enhanced customer engagement and loyalty, reducing churn by 10%.

Overcoming Implementation Challenges

Building an AI operating system isn't without its hurdles. Here are some common challenges and how I tackled them:

Data Privacy Concerns

Handling sensitive data requires stringent security measures. I ensured compliance with regulations by implementing robust encryption and access controls.

Integration Complexities

Merging existing systems with new AI technologies posed integration challenges. We adopted modular architectures to facilitate seamless connectivity, as suggested by Cornerstone OnDemand.

Employee Adaptation

Transitioning to an AI-driven environment required a cultural shift. We prioritized training and support to help employees adapt to new tools and processes, a strategy supported by Harvard Business Review.

Best Practices for Implementing AI in Publishing

  1. Start Small: Begin with manageable projects to build confidence and demonstrate value.
  2. Focus on Data Quality: Clean, structured data is critical for effective AI implementation.
  3. Encourage Collaboration: Involve stakeholders from different departments to align goals and expectations.
  4. Monitor and Adapt: Continuously monitor AI performance and make necessary adjustments.
  5. Prioritize Security: Protect sensitive data with robust security measures.
